FBI Raids Anti-War Activists: Boston Responds.

ø

Protesting FBI raids outside JFK Federal Building 9/27/10
Democracy Now reported FBI Raids Homes of Antiwar and Pro-Palestinian Activists in Chicago and Minneapolis.

Boston May Day Coalition called for ACTION: MON SEPT 27 4:00-6:00 PM JFK Federal Building.

Amy Goodman interviewed former FBI special agent Coleen Rowley, the woman who blew the whistle on FBI incompetence leading up to 9/11.

A few days after the raids in her hometown of Minneapolis, she told me, “This is not the first time that you’ve seen this Orwellian turn of the war on terror onto domestic peace groups and social justice groups … we had that begin very quickly after 9/11, and there were Office of Legal Counsel opinions that said the First Amendment no longer controls the war on terror.”

Amy also mentions FBI surveillance of activists groups including Green Peace. To my young friend campaigning for them in Harvard Square, I offer a link to the ACLU of Massachusetts website. The woman with the lovely white hair above is Nancy Murray from ACLU. The eye candy with the moustache and hat on the extreme left is Geoff Karens of the Harvard Union of Clerical and Technical Workers.

Amy’s column, “FBI Raids and the Criminalization of Dissent“.
